Why “Free” Is Just a Marketing Term, Not a Gift

Marketing teams love to slap “free” on everything like it’s a charity donation. And players, bless their hopeful hearts, think a handful of spins will magically turn their bankroll into a fortune. In reality the only thing free is the irritation you feel when the terms reveal a 0.5% cash‑out limit.

Take Betway’s latest live dealer promotion. They hand out five “free” spins on a blackjack side game, then force you to wager the winnings ten times before you can even think about withdrawing. It’s a cold math problem: 5 spins × average RTP 96% = 4.8 units. Multiply by the 10× wagering requirement, and you’re staring at 48 units you’ll never see. The casino isn’t giving away money; it’s pocketing it.

DraftKings tries a different tack. Their live roulette table offers a single free spin on the wheel, but the spin only counts if the ball lands on zero. Zero, the odds‑defying black spot that appears once every 37 turns. That’s not a “gift”; that’s a lottery ticket sold at a premium price.

Even 888casino, which boasts a sleek interface, slips into the same routine. They brand their live baccarat bonus as “VIP treatment,” yet the minimum bet for the free spin sits at a modest $2.00. Your “VIP” status evaporates the moment you hit the withdrawal page and discover a $25 processing fee.

What to Watch For When Chasing Those “Best” Free Spins

First, scan the promotional banner for the phrase “best live casino free spins Canada.” If the tagline is screaming that phrase, you’re already in a hype loop. Their actual offering will be tucked away in a 2,000‑word T&C doc titled “Rules and Regulations.” If you can’t decipher the legalese without a calculator, you’re not getting a good deal.

Second, measure the spin value against the minimum deposit. A $5 free spin attached to a $50 deposit is a bargain only if you plan to lose the $50 anyway. If your bankroll can’t stomach the deposit, the “best” spin becomes a paperweight.

Third, examine the cash‑out window. Some live casinos only allow you to withdraw winnings within 24 hours of the spin. Others force you to play through a night‑long session before you can even request a payout. The tighter the window, the more you’ll feel pressured to chase losses, which is exactly what the house wants.
